Human rights activist Igor Nagavkin was released from custody
The Moscow City Court, at a meeting to extend the preventive measure, released human rights activist Igor Nagavkin, accused of theft, from custody. This was reported on the website of the movement "For Human Rights". The court called the reasons for releasing Nagavkin the delay in the proceedings, the violation of territorial jurisdiction and the inability of the investigator to explain in any way the need to extend the arrest of the accused.

A fifth criminal case was opened against convicted human rights activist Sergei Mokhnatkin
A fifth criminal case has been opened against convicted human rights activist Sergei Mokhnatkin, reported the Arkhangelsk news portal 29.ru on November 14. According to the information indicated on the website, the Investigative Department of the Investigative Committee for the Arkhangelsk Region confirmed this information to the publication. Mokhnatkin is suspected of disorganizing the activities of the penal colony (Article 321 of the Criminal Code).

In Yekaterinburg, the fine for a participant in the September 9 action with a disability due to schizophrenia was canceled
The Sverdlovsk Regional Court overturned the decision to impose a fine on Anton K., a participant in the action on September 9 with a disability. The case was sent for a new trial. This is reported by Wikinews. The man was assigned the second group of disability in connection with schizophrenia, diagnosed more than 10 years ago. Earlier, Judge Denis Abashev of the Kirovsky District Court of Yekaterinburg fined the protester 10,000 rubles.

A St. Petersburg resident was fired from his job due to a long arrest for an action against Solovyov
In St. Petersburg, management fired activist Pavel Ivankin, who was arrested for 10 days for an action against TV presenter Vladimir Solovyov. Ivankin himself told OVD-Info about this. The activist worked as a manager in a private company. The bosses always knew about his political activity and had nothing against it, but after his arrest they decided that the manager could not miss so many working days.

In Perm, the author of the art object “Death is not far off” was fined
In the court district No. 1 of the Leninsky district of Perm, Aleksey Ilkaev, an artist, was fined 15,000 rubles for replacing the word “happiness” with the word “death” in the art object “Happiness is not far off.” It is reported by RIA Novosti with reference to the artist's lawyer Sergei Kalkatin.

A Ugra newspaper was searched in connection with the case of a journalist who criticized officials.
The editorial office of the Yugorsky Express newspaper was searched in connection with the case of Eduard Shmonin, the creator of the Chinovnik.ru portal, which published critical notes about local authorities. This was reported by MBH Media with reference to a newspaper representative. The interlocutor of the publication did not disclose the details of the search, as they took a non-disclosure subscription from all the newspaper's employees.

In Kazan, a report was drawn up against a Tatar activist because of a post with a Celtic cross
Policemen in Kazan have filed a protocol against Batyrkhan Agzamov, an activist of the Union of Tatar Youth Azatlyk, because of the publication of a Celtic cross on the Internet. This young man told the newspaper "Kommersant" Employees of the Zarechensky police department drew up a protocol against Agzamov under part 1 of Article 20.3 of the Code of Administrative Offenses (public display of Nazi paraphernalia).

Mass searches took place in the homes of Jehovah's Witnesses in Crimea
At night in Dzhankoy, searches were carried out in several dozen houses of followers of Jehovah's Witnesses. The head of the regional group, Sergei Filatov, was detained. Journalist Anton Naumlyuk reported this on his Facebook. As Naumlyuk wrote, FSB officers in Crimea carried out a large-scale operation, during which searches and detentions took place at several dozen addresses.
